Leave A Light On

Rating: 5.0

I linger sadly upon this earthly realm
Reminiscing of a life with you at the helm
You've left for heaven, where I long to be
I yearn to follow; leave a light on for me

Tired of sitting around at night
Pleading for some deathly delight
I'm lost without my loving wife
Just striving for the afterlife

There was only ever you and me
True love is how it's meant to be
My heart was a gift I gave to you
And you devoted your heart too

I miss you so very much
Dreaming of your gentle touch
But help comes when you need it most
Mine came in the form of your Holy Ghost

You raised my sail and set my course
Beyond the stars, right to the source
To a paradise of overwhelming glee
Thank you darling, for leaving a light on for me

POET'S NOTES ABOUT THE POEM
This poem is about a man who is struggling to cope after his wife has passed away, as he is moments from death he sees the ghostly figure of his wife as she calls him into the afterlife so they can be reunited.
